What is the Stock Market?
The stock market is a collection of companies that are publicly traded on the stock exchange. Investors buy shares in these companies, hoping to make a profit as the company grows and its share price rises. The stock market also allows investors to diversify their investments, spreading their money across different companies and industries.
How Does the Stock Market Work?
When you invest in stocks, you are buying shares in a company. When you buy a share, you become a part-owner of the company. As the company's fortunes rise or fall, so will the value of your shares. Companies usually pay dividends to their shareholders, which are payments based on their profits.

Good luck!Step 2: Choose the right stocks
Once you've figured out your budget, it's time to start thinking about which stocks you'd like to invest in. This is often the trickiest part of investing and can take a bit of research. The good news is that there are plenty of sources of advice out there, from financial advisers to online tools and apps.When it comes to selecting stocks, there are two main approaches you can take – fundamental analysis and technical analysis. Fundamental analysis looks at the financials of a company, such as its balance sheet, income statement and cash flow, to gauge its potential for growth. Technical analysis looks at patterns in the historical price and volume data to predict how the stock might move in the future.Diversify your portfolio

First, let’s define what stocks are. Stocks (also known as equities) are units of ownership of a company. When you purchase stocks, you become a shareholder of that company and have a claim on its profits and assets. Companies issue stocks to raise money for various purposes, such as expanding their business or financing new projects.How Do You Make Money From Stocks?
When you buy stocks, you hope they will increase in value over time. This is known as capital appreciation. You can also earn money from dividends, which are payments made by companies to their shareholders. Dividends are typically paid out quarterly or annually, depending on the company.What Are The Risks Of Investing In Stocks?
It’s important to understand that investing in stocks carries some risk. Stocks can go up or down in value at any time, so there’s always a chance that you could lose some or all of your investment. It’s important to do your research and understand the risks before investing.Types Of Stocks
There are two main types of stocks: common and preferred. Common stocks represent ownership of a company and come with voting rights. Preferred stocks are similar to bonds and pay regular dividends but don’t come with voting rights.How To Start Investing In Stocks
